McDonald’s Chocolate Milkshake Copycat Recipe

My son is a chocoholic who loves everything that involves rich and creamy chocolate. One of his favorite treats is McDonald’s Chocolate Milkshake. That’s why, on his birthdays, it has always been my special ritual to bake him a chocolate cake from scratch.

How-To-Make-McDonald_s Chocolate Milkshake At Home

But for his 13th birthday, I decided to make it extra special. That’s when it hit me: why not whip up his favorite milkshake from scratch? It was the perfect way to add a personal touch to his day.

I was overjoyed when I learned that making this Chocolate Milkshake was no rocket science. With just four ingredients and simple steps, the shake was ready quickly. It was one of the biggest hits at my son’s birthday party.

Since then, this milkshake has become a part of our family’s weekend routine. This delicious shake is so creamy and chocolaty that it makes your taste buds dance joyfully. 

If you’re a chocolate lover and haven’t tried this before, I bet you will instantly fall in love with it. So, let’s dig into this simple and easy chocolate milkshake recipe, which will be ready in no time.

Equipment Required 

  • Small Bowls: I use small bowls to assemble all the ingredients before starting with the prep for a shake.
  • Blending Jar: While I use a blending jar, you can use a hand mixer to blend all the ingredients.
  • Serving Glass: You can use any fancy-looking glass to serve this delicious chocolate milkshake.
McD Chocolate Shake

Preparation And Cooking Time

Preparation TimeTotal Time
5 Minutes5 Minutes

How To Make McDonald’s Chocolate Milkshake At Home

McDonald s Chocolate Milkshake Step 1

Add the milk in a jar.

McDonald s Chocolate Milkshake Step 2
How To Make McDonald s Chocolate Milkshake At Home

McDonald’s Chocolate Milkshake Recipe Video

Top Tips

Expert Tips That I Recommend

  • I usually add ice cubes to the blender while making the shake, which makes my drink cold and gives it a crystalized texture to make it thicker. However, I do this only when I am serving it immediately, as the consistency of the shake gets thinner as the ice melts.
  • Although it is not required, I add some full-fat chocolate ice cream to get the best flavors of this milkshake.
  • If you want this shake to have more of a chocolate kick, you can also add nutella or hot fudge.
  • I sometimes also vary this recipe by adding fresh fruits like bananas or strawberries. This gives the shake a fruity flavor and a healthy twist.
  • You can also experiment with the garnish. I usually drizzle caramel syrup on a dollop of whipped cream to garnish this shake, but you can add any sprinkles of your choice.
  • To make this shake healthier, I also like adding some nuts, like roasted almonds, pistachios, or hazelnuts, to add that crunchy texture to this creamy and chocolaty milkshake.
  • Sometimes, when I have plenty of time, I prefer making this shake ahead of time and then refrigerating it. This allows the flavors in the shake to meld together while it is chilled.

FAQs About McDonald’s Chocolate Milkshake

Nutritional Information Per Serving

This McDonald’s Chocolate Milkshake is high in fat and calories. Hence, I recommend that you have it in moderation. Also, I have added the nutritional values of the ingredients used in this recipe for your reference in the table below:

Calories850 kcal
Total Fat54 g
Saturated Fat33 g
Polyunsaturated Fat2 g
Monounsaturated13 g
Cholesterol172 mg
Sodium193 mg
Total Carbohydrates81 g
Dietary Fiber2 g
Total Sugars72 g
Protein15 g
Vitamin C1 mg
Vitamin A2251 IU
Calcium468 mg
Iron1 mg
Potassium712 mg

This chocolate milkshake is suitable for people following a vegetarian and gluten-free diet.

Restaurant Style Milkshake Recipe

Recipe Variations For Different Diets

  • Vegan Diet: People following a vegan diet can substitute milk for almond, soy, or oat milk in this recipe. Additionally, the whipped cream can be substituted by coconut cream to make this recipe absolutely vegan-friendly.
  • Keto-Friendly Diet: I make this chocolate milkshake keto-friendly by blending almond milk with liquid sweeteners, sugar-free cacao powder, and heavy cream. Trust me, it tastes delicious, as I, too, follow a keto diet and always search for variations to suit myself.
  • Sugar-Free Diet: People following a sugar-free diet can substitute sugar-free chocolate syrup and liquid sweeteners to enjoy this delicious drink.

Storing This Recipe

  • Counter: The milkshake should not be kept at room temperature for over an hour.
  • Fridge: I store the leftovers of this chocolate milkshake in a tightly sealed glass or jar, as they can absorb the aroma of other food items kept in the fridge. They can last for up to 2 days in the fridge.
  • Freezer: It isn’t that common to store milkshakes in the freezer, but they can be stored in an airtight container for 1 to 2 weeks.

What To Serve With This Recipe

I like this chocolate milkshake alongside Fries, while my son enjoys it alone. I also served it to my guests with some Fresh Fruit Salad and Freshly Baked Cake.

In addition to these delicious food items, you can also serve this shake alongside savory dishes or snacks like Mozzarella Sticks, Juicy Chicken Burgers, wraps, and coleslaw sandwiches.

Printable Version

McDonald’s Chocolate Milkshake Copycat Recipe

Author : Poonam
Serving : 2
Calories : 850 kcal
Total time : 10 minutes
McDonald's Chocolate Milkshake is a rich and creamy beverage made by blending vanilla reduced-fat ice cream with chocolate syrup, topped with whipped light cream. You can further top it whipping cream or simply garnish it with cocoa powder.
No ratings yet
LEAVE REVIEW »

Ingredients

  • 300 ml Milk
  • 3 Tbsp Chocolate Syrup
  • 2 Tbsp Sugar
  • ½ Cup Whipping Cream
  • Cocoa Powder For Garnish (optional)

Equipment

  • Small Bowls
  • Blending Jar
  • Serving Glass

Instructions
 

  • Add the milk in a jar.
    McDonald_s Chocolate Milkshake Step 1
  • Combine the milk, sugar, chocolate syrup, and heavy cream and blend until smooth.
    McDonald_s Chocolate Milkshake Step 2
  • Pour the shake in the glass and sprinkle some chocolate powder on top for garnish.
    How-To-Make-McDonald_s Chocolate Milkshake At Home

Video

Notes

      1. I usually add ice cubes to the blender while making the shake, which makes my drink cold and gives it a crystalized texture to make it thicker. However, I do this only when I am serving it immediately, as the consistency of the shake gets thinner as the ice melts.
      1. Although it is not required, I add some full-fat chocolate ice cream to get the best flavors of this milkshake.
      2. If you want this shake to have more of a chocolate kick, you can also add nutella or hot fudge.
      3. I sometimes also vary this recipe by adding fresh fruits like bananas or strawberries. This gives the shake a fruity flavor and a healthy twist.
      4. You can also experiment with the garnish. I usually drizzle caramel syrup on a dollop of whipped cream to garnish this shake, but you can add any sprinkles of your choice.
      5. To make this shake healthier, I also like adding some nuts, like roasted almonds, pistachios, or hazelnuts, to add that crunchy texture to this creamy and chocolaty milkshake.
      6. Sometimes, when I have plenty of time, I prefer making this shake ahead of time and then refrigerating it. This allows the flavors in the shake to meld together while it is chilled.
Prep Time : 5 minutes
Cook Time : 5 minutes
Total Time : 10 minutes
Cuisine : American
Course : Copycat Recipes

Nutrition

Calories : 850kcal  |  Carbohydrates : 81g  |  Protein : 15g  |  Fat : 54g  |  Saturated Fat : 33g  |  Polyunsaturated Fat : 2g  |  Monounsaturated Fat : 13g  |  Cholesterol : 172mg  |  Sodium : 193mg  |  Potassium : 712mg  |  Fiber : 2g  |  Sugar : 72g  |  Vitamin A : 2251IU  |  Vitamin C : 1mg  |  Calcium : 468mg  |  Iron : 1mg

More McDonald’s Recipes That You Can Try

Conclusion

This copycat recipe for McDonald’s Chocolate Milkshake is every chocolate lover’s delight. Rich in chocolate and creamy texture, this milkshake has become everyone’s favorite.

So, try out this delicious drink this summer to beat the heat and enjoy it with your loved ones. Once you’re done relishing this drink, don’t forget to leave your comment about your opinion of this recipe in the comment section below.

Leave a Comment

Your email address will not be published. Required fields are marked *

Recipe Rating